Research has identified many conditions that contribute to falling. These are called risk factors. Many risk factors can be changed or modified to help prevent falls. They include: 1. Lower body weakness 2. Vitamin D deficiency (that is, not enough vitamin D in your system) 3. Difficulties with walking and balance 4. Use … See more Many falls do not cause injuries. But one out of five falls does cause a serious injury such as a broken bone or a head injury.4,5These injuries can make it hard for a person to get around, do everyday activities, or live on … See more

WebCompression fractures are small breaks or cracks in the vertebrae (the bones that make up your spinal column). The breaks happen in the vertebral body, which is the thick, rounded part on the front of each vertebra. Fractures in the bone cause the spine to weaken and collapse. Over time, these fractures affect posture.
